自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(63)
  • 收藏
  • 关注

转载 ctype.h

isalpha:int isalpha(char ch);检查ch是否是字母.是字母返回非0,否则返回0。iscntrl:int iscntrl(int ch);检查ch是否控制字符(其ASCII码在0和0x1F之间,数值为 0-31).是返回非0,否则返回 0.isdigit:int isdigit(char ch);检查ch是否是数字(0-9),是返回非0,否则返回0。i...

2018-01-31 21:57:00 55

转载 基于FPGA的异步FIFO设计

今天要介绍的异步FIFO,可以有不同的读写时钟,即不同的时钟域。由于异步FIFO没有外部地址端口,因此内部采用读写指针并顺序读写,即先写进FIFO的数据先读取(简称先进先出)。这里的读写指针是异步的,处理不同的时钟域,而异步FIFO的空满标志位是根据读写指针的情况得到的。为了得到正确的空满标志位,需要对读写指针进行同步。一般情况下,如果一个时钟域的信号直接给另一个时钟域采集,可能会产生亚稳态,亚稳...

2018-01-31 14:43:00 357

转载 Nodejs Guides(四)

EVENTSevents模块API实例const EventEmitter = require('events');class MyEmitter extends EventEmitter {}//EventListener 会按照监听器注册的顺序同步地调用所有监听器。//所以需要确保事件的正确排序且避免竞争条件或逻辑错误。//监听器函数可以使用 setImm...

2018-01-31 11:01:00 46

转载 Java中this与super的区别

2019独角兽企业重金招聘Python工程师标准>>> ...

2018-01-30 16:48:00 36

转载 用Vue搭建一个应用盒子(二):datetime-picker

接着上次的进度,我们已经实现了一个todo-list。它已经具备了基本的功能,可以新建、编辑、删除任务。但是美中不足的是,它的时间设定上只能通过输入一段字符串来设定,很不社会。我们应该完成的效果是一个time-picker,日期选择器。本来打算自己造轮子,无奈公司最近一段时间项目赶得紧,加上生活上遇到了一点挫折,直到7月初才有空闲下来想想...

2018-01-30 15:48:35 108

转载 Vue根据菜单json数据动态按需加载路由Vue-router

每个菜单项对应一个页面组件,根据菜单项动态按需加载路由路由配置的正确写法:/*router/index.js*/import Vue from 'vue'import Router from 'vue-router'import url from './url'import store from '../store'Vue.use(Router)const router =...

2018-01-30 05:36:53 1915

转载 苹果ios用js的Date()出现NaN问题解决办法

原文:苹果ios用js的Date()出现NaN问题解决办法 ios使用如下方法获得NaN,安卓手机则是正常计算,解决方法是换个这个时间的格式new Date("2017-04-28 23:59:59").getTime()换成如下方式就正常了,就是‘-’换成‘/’new Date("2017/04/28 23:59:59").getTime() ...

2018-01-29 14:06:00 76

原创 区块链每日投资指南(0129)-证监会副主席表示数字货币需要监管

上一周的走势依然是工作日下跌,周末拉升的结局。这主要原因依然是,周末不上班。最终政策出炉之前,市场恐怕还将继续震荡。下周的工作日恐怕会重演下跌的节奏。但是经过了17号,23号,26号三次筑底来看,如果政策最终不是大雷,比如禁止C2C交易,屏蔽所有交易网站。那么后市绝对会冲破前期的20000美元高点。如果最终大雷这两个都爆了的话,那么肯定还要进行一次瀑布型下跌。因为大量的韭菜是不会挂VPN的。不要小...

2018-01-29 06:40:49 105

转载 Atitit.ati orm的设计and架构总结 适用于java c# php版

Atitit.ati orm的设计and架构总结 适用于java c# php版 1. Orm的目标11.1. 动态obj11.2. Hb的api(meger,save,update,del)12. Orm的概念13. 动态obj24. 參考4      1. Orm的目标1.1. 动态obj1.2. ...

2018-01-28 19:59:00 59

转载 Packagist / Composer 中国全量镜像

Packagist / Composer中国全量镜像本镜像共缓存了186695个项目(package)、Millions个(zip)安装包。最后同步时间:2018/1/28 上午11:01:13。Composer 最新版本:1.6.2立即使用赞助Packagist 镜...

2018-01-28 13:40:00 59

转载 Vue基础知识

参数 var vm = new Vue({ el:'#app',//绑定元素 data:{ message:'helloworld' },//数据 methods:{ sayhi:function(){ alert('hi'); } },//方法 mounted:function(){ cons...

2018-01-27 10:08:00 40

转载 mybatis中mysql转义讲解

本文为博主原创,未经允许不得转载:      在mybatis中写sql的时候,遇到特殊字符在加载解析的时候,会进行转义,所以在mybatis中写sql语句的时候,遇到特殊字符进行转义处理。       需要注意的是,转义的字符为以下几个,记住就可以了。 < < > > <&am...

2018-01-26 15:17:00 205

转载 APP测试流程和测试点

1 APP测试基本流程1.1流程图1.2测试周期测试周期可按项目的开发周期来确定测试时间,一般测试时间为两三周(即15个工作日),根据项目情况以及版本质量可适当缩短或延长测试时间。正式测试前先向主管确认项目排期。1.3测试资源测试任务开始前,检查各项测试资源。--产品功能需求文档;--产品原型图;--产品效果图;--行为统计分析定义文档;--测试设备(ios3.1.3-ios5...

2018-01-26 15:11:07 51

转载 Collections,Synchronized

import java.util.ArrayList;import java.util.Collections;import java.util.Iterator;import java.util.List;//public static Collection synchronizedCollention(Collection c...

2018-01-26 09:53:00 95

转载 Linux学习笔记之一————什么是Linux及其应用领域

1.1认识Linux 1)什么是操作系统 2)现实生活中的操作系统win7Mac Android iOS 3) 操作系统的发展史(1)Unix1965年之前的时候,电脑并不像现在一样普遍,它可不是一般人能碰的起的,除非是军事或者学院的研究机构,而且当时大型主机至多能提供30台终端(30个键盘、显示器),连接一台电脑为了解决数量不够用的问题1965年左后由贝...

2018-01-24 16:42:00 73

转载 第6章 循环

6.1range 函数用来创建一个数字列表,它的范围是从起始数字开始到结束数字之前1 >>> for x in range(0,5):2 print('Hello %s' % x)3 4 Hello 05 Hello 16 Hello 27 Hello 38 Hello 41 >>> ...

2018-01-24 14:51:00 47

转载 jsonp-反向代理-CORS解决JS跨域问题的个人总结

jsonp-反向代理-CORS解决JS跨域问题的个人总结网上说了很多很多,但是看完之后还是很混乱,所以我自己重新总结一下。解决 js 跨域问题一共有8种方法,jsonp(只支持 get)反向代理CORSdocument.domain + iframe 跨域window.name + iframe 跨域window.pos...

2018-01-24 10:12:04 183

转载 123

sd转载于:https://blog.51cto.com/7907778/2064386

2018-01-23 21:24:41 51

转载 leetcode 66 Plus One

给定一个数组,表示整数的各个位数,现要将其加上1,考虑进位。vector<int> plusOne(vector<int>& digits) { int size = digits.size(); bool carry = true; for (int i = size - 1; i >= 0; --i) { ...

2018-01-23 00:58:00 51

转载 shell printf命令:格式化输出语句

shell printf命令:格式化输出语句注意:使用printf的脚本比使用echo移植性好。如同echo命令,printf命令可以输出简单的字符串:[root@master ~]#printf "Hello, Shell\n"Hello, Shellprintf不像echo那样会自动提供一个换行符号。你必须显式地将换行符号指定成\n。printf命令的完整语法有两个部分:printf的语法格式...

2018-01-22 20:09:50 81

转载 【转】 ConstraintLayout 完全解析 快来优化你的布局吧

转自:http://blog.csdn.net/lmj623565791/article/details/78011599本文出自张鸿洋的博客一、概述ConstraintLayout出现有一段时间了,不过一直没有特别去关注,也多多少少看了一些文字介绍,多数都是对使用可视化布局拖拽,个人对拖拽一直不看好,直到前段时间看到该文:解析ConstraintLayout的...

2018-01-22 14:24:00 59

转载 BGP-MED-2

BGP-MED-2如图:当AS100去往AS300的60、10的网络时,60走R3,10走R1!使用MED属性影响选路!R2的配置bgp 200peer 1.1.1.1 as-number 100 peer 1.1.1.1 ebgp-max-hop 255 peer 1.1.1.1 connect-interface LoopBack0peer 4.4.4.4 as-number 200 pe...

2018-01-22 12:30:16 74

转载 Pressed状态和clickable,duplicateParentState的关系

    做Android开发的人都用过Selector,可以方便的实现View在不同状态下的背景。不过,相信大部分开发者遇到过和我一样的问题,本文会从源码角度,解释这些问题。        首先,这里简单描述一下,我遇到的问题:界面上有个全屏的LinearLayout A,A中有一个TextView B和Button C,其中,A的clickable=true,并设置了pressed时...

2018-01-22 11:22:00 160

转载 ios元素定位

原文地址http://www.cnblogs.com/meitian/p/7373460.html第一种:通过Appium1.6的Inspector来查看具体安装方式前面的随笔已经介绍了:http://www.cnblogs.com/meitian/p/7360017.html可以通过定位找到元素xpath或name 个人不推荐用这个方法,实际操作中发现,每次操作后点击刷新比较慢,而且...

2018-01-22 00:24:00 133

转载 设计模式-工厂方法(Factory Method)

2018-1-20 by Atlas设计思想核心工厂类不再负责所有产品的创建,而是将具体创建的工作交给子类去做,成为一个抽象工厂角色,仅负责给出具体工厂类必须实现的接口,而不接触哪一个产品类应当被实例化这种细节。应用场景Template Method Pattern是在父类建立处理逻辑的大纲骨架,而在子类补充具体的处理内容。把Template Method Pattern应...

2018-01-21 04:06:33 57

转载 指针

指针 题目一: 计算两数的和与差本题要求实现一个计算输入的两数的和与差的简单函数。函数接口定义:void sum_diff( float op1, float op2, float psum, float pdiff );其中op1和op2是输入的两个实数,psum和pdiff是计算得出的和与差。裁判测试程序样例:include ...

2018-01-20 09:44:00 90

转载 探索java世界中的日志奥秘

java日志简单介绍对于一个应用程序来说日志记录是必不可少的一部分。线上问题追踪,基于日志的业务逻辑统计分析等都离不日志。JAVA领域存在多种日志框架,目前常用的日志框架包括Log4j,Log4j 2,Commons Logging,Slf4j,Logback,Jul等。一、java日志发...

2018-01-19 10:43:00 118

转载 Mysql清空表(truncate)与删除表中数据(delete)的区别

2019独角兽企业重金招聘Python工程师标准>>> ...

2018-01-18 17:01:00 75

转载 将不确定变为确定~老赵写的CodeTimer是代码性能测试的利器

首先,非常感谢赵老大的CodeTimer,它让我们更好的了解到代码执行的性能,从而可以让我们从性能的角度来考虑问题,有些东西可能我们认为是这样的,但经理测试并非如何,这正应了我之前的那名话:“机器最能证明一切”!费话就不说了,看代码吧: 1 /// <summary> 2 /// 执行代码规范 3 /// </summary&...

2018-01-18 12:49:00 67

转载 CentOS7安装EPEL源

CentOS7安装EPEL[lijiayun@centos-*** ~]$ yum install epel-release已加载插件:fastestmirror, langpacks您需要 root 权限执行此命令。[lijiayun@centos-*** ~]$ su密码:[root@centos-*** lijiayun]# yum install epel-release已加载插件:fa...

2018-01-18 11:21:34 402

转载 51. Python 数据处理(2)

1.Python 修改excel文件importxlrdimportxlutils.copyexcelr=xlrd.open_workbook("hello.xlsx")excelw=xlutils.copy.copy(excelr)sheet1=excelw.get_sheet(0)sheet1.write(3,5,"xlutils.copy...

2018-01-18 10:56:40 94

转载 Android FrameWork学习(一)Android 7 0系统源码下载 编译

最近计划着研究下 Android 7.0 的系统源码,之前也没做过什么记录,这次正好将学习的内容记录下来,方便以后复习巩固。既然要学习我们的系统源码,那我们第一步要做的就是下载源码并进行编译了。#硬件环境要求###1. 编译环境按照官方的说法,编译 Android 2.3.x 及以上版本的系统源码需要 64 位的系统运行环境来支持,而编译 2.3.x 以下的版本则需要 32 位的系统运行...

2018-01-18 08:12:38 64

转载 Android 4 +https(如何启动TLS1 1 and TLS1 2)

之前用的网络请求框架是鸿洋的OkHttpUtils,网络请求在5.0手机上使用https没有问题,但是最近突然使用了一个4.4的系统,就报错SSLException ....咋地咋地然后 我们的副总给我们找一个博客,如何解决4.+系统出现的这个问题(虽然我现在还很有点懵逼...),然后添加上去后,就可以使用了。在Okgo ,OkHttpUtils 都可以用,那么的网络请求应该也可以用?...

2018-01-18 08:06:23 731

转载 Java编程思想 学习笔记1

一、对象导论1.抽象过程   Alan Kay曾经总结了第一个成功的面向对象语言、同时也是Java所基于的语言之一的Smalltalk的五个基本特性,这些特性表现了纯粹的面向对象程序设计方式   1)万物皆对象。   2)程序是对象的集合,它们通过发送消息来告知彼此所要做的。要想请求一个对象,就必须对该对象发送一条消息。更具体的说,可以把消息想象为对某个特定对...

2018-01-17 23:47:00 56

转载 redis 安装错误 jemalloc.h: No such file or directory

为什么80%的码农都做不了架构师?>>> ...

2018-01-16 19:03:00 131

转载 SaltStack入门篇之远程执行和配置管理

一、SaltStack概述Salt,,一种全新的基础设施管理方式,部署轻松,在几分钟内可运行起来,扩展性好,很容易管理上万台服务器,速度够快,服务器之间秒级通讯。salt底层采用动态的连接总线, 使其可以用于编配, 远程执行, 配置管理等等.多种配置管理工具对比:Puppet(rubby开发,现在很少使用)ansible(python开发,轻量级,没有agent,大规模环境下使用ssh会很慢...

2018-01-16 17:00:39 87

转载 C++获取本机的ip地址程序

C++获取本机的ip地址程序 #include <WinSock2.h>#pragma comment(lib,"ws2_32") //链接到ws2_32动态链接库class CInitSock{public: CInitSock(BYTE minorVer = 2,BYTE majo...

2018-01-16 11:40:00 341

转载 MongoDB

一: 简介MongoDB是一款强大、灵活、且易于扩展的通用型数据库1、易用性MongoDB是一个面向文档(document-oriented)的数据库,而不是关系型数据库。不采用关系型主要是为了获得更好得扩展性。当然还有一些其他好处,与关系数据库相比,面向文档的数据库不再有“行“(row)的概念取而代之的是更为灵活的“文档”(document)模型。通过在文...

2018-01-15 17:40:00 324

转载 如何用grep命令同时显示“匹配行”上下的n行?

如何用grep命令同时显示匹配行上下的n行 标准unix/linux下的grep通过以下参数控制上下文grep -C 5 foo file 显示file文件中匹配foo字串那行以及上下5行grep -B 5 foo file 显示foo及前5行grep -A 5 foo file 显示foo及后5行...

2018-01-15 15:04:00 293

转载 去创业公司不能有一夜暴富的侥幸,更不能指望掉馅饼

为了实现财务自由,去创业公司是一个不错的选项,我自己也去过创业公司,身边的朋友也有不少去过或正在创业公司里干,我就结合下我经历过的和我看到的,说下我的感受。1 该去哪种类型的创业公司 第一,这个公司一定要有盈利点,而且目前市场上这块做的人比较少,大家可以对比下最近崛起的一些创业公司,比如摩拜单车或之前的滴滴打车,创业点一般能给大家创造便利,或减轻公司的成本。 ...

2018-01-15 09:08:00 59

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除